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
D
DataCenter_Core2.1_20190520
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
bltdc
DataCenter_Core2.1_20190520
Commits
db8a322b
Commit
db8a322b
authored
Feb 19, 2020
by
guanzhenshan
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
是否合理报表增加字段
parent
84c8192b
Hide whitespace changes
Inline
Side-by-side
Showing
3 changed files
with
25 additions
and
11 deletions
+25
-11
FinanceReportServices.cs
Bailun.DC.Services/FinanceReportServices.cs
+1
-1
FinanceController.cs
Bailun.DC.Web/Areas/Reports/Controllers/FinanceController.cs
+9
-5
ListUnReasonable.cshtml
...C.Web/Areas/Reports/Views/Finance/ListUnReasonable.cshtml
+15
-5
No files found.
Bailun.DC.Services/FinanceReportServices.cs
View file @
db8a322b
...
@@ -5081,7 +5081,7 @@ group by currency";
...
@@ -5081,7 +5081,7 @@ group by currency";
public
List
<
dc_mid_month_sale_putin_report
>
ListMonthSalePutinDetail
(
BtTableParameter
parameter
,
string
month
,
string
warehousetype
,
string
warehouse
,
int
?
type
,
int
?
isclear
,
int
?
isnew
,
int
?
isaims
,
ref
int
total
,
int
isreasonable
=-
1
)
public
List
<
dc_mid_month_sale_putin_report
>
ListMonthSalePutinDetail
(
BtTableParameter
parameter
,
string
month
,
string
warehousetype
,
string
warehouse
,
int
?
type
,
int
?
isclear
,
int
?
isnew
,
int
?
isaims
,
ref
int
total
,
int
isreasonable
=-
1
)
{
{
var
sqlparam
=
new
DynamicParameters
();
var
sqlparam
=
new
DynamicParameters
();
var
sql
=
$@"select t1.warehouse_type,t1.warehouse_code,t1.warehouse_name,t1.bailun_sku,t1.count_putin,(t1.count_putin*t1.buyprice) amount_putin,t1.count_outbound,(t1.count_outbound*t1.buyprice) amount_outbound,(t1.count_putin-t1.count_outbound) count_diff,((t1.count_putin-t1.count_outbound)*t1.buyprice) amount_diff,t2.is_clear,t2.is_new,t2.is_aimsorder,t2.count_usable_stock,t2.avg_sevenday_sales,t2.avg_fourteenday_sales,t2.avg_thirtyday_sales,t2.avg_sales,t2.sale_putin_id from dc_mid_month_sale_putin t1
var
sql
=
$@"select t1.warehouse_type,t1.warehouse_code,t1.warehouse_name,t1.bailun_sku,t1.count_putin,(t1.count_putin*t1.buyprice) amount_putin,t1.count_outbound,(t1.count_outbound*t1.buyprice) amount_outbound,(t1.count_putin-t1.count_outbound) count_diff,((t1.count_putin-t1.count_outbound)*t1.buyprice) amount_diff,t2.is_clear,t2.is_new,t2.is_aimsorder,t2.count_usable_stock,t2.avg_sevenday_sales,t2.avg_fourteenday_sales,t2.avg_thirtyday_sales,t2.avg_sales,t2.sale_putin_id
,t2.avg_weighting_day_sales,t1.category_simple_name
from dc_mid_month_sale_putin t1
left join dc_mid_month_sale_putin_report t2 on t1.id=t2.sale_putin_id
left join dc_mid_month_sale_putin_report t2 on t1.id=t2.sale_putin_id
where t1.`month`='
{
month
}
'"
;
where t1.`month`='
{
month
}
'"
;
...
...
Bailun.DC.Web/Areas/Reports/Controllers/FinanceController.cs
View file @
db8a322b
...
@@ -6480,6 +6480,7 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
...
@@ -6480,6 +6480,7 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
a
.
amount_putin
,
a
.
amount_putin
,
a
.
count_diff
,
a
.
count_diff
,
a
.
amount_diff
,
a
.
amount_diff
,
a
.
category_simple_name
,
is_clear
=
(
a
.
is_clear
??
0
)==
0
?
"否"
:
"是"
,
is_clear
=
(
a
.
is_clear
??
0
)==
0
?
"否"
:
"是"
,
is_new
=
(
a
.
is_new
??
0
)==
0
?
"否"
:
"是"
,
is_new
=
(
a
.
is_new
??
0
)==
0
?
"否"
:
"是"
,
...
@@ -6489,6 +6490,7 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
...
@@ -6489,6 +6490,7 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
a
.
avg_fourteenday_sales
,
a
.
avg_fourteenday_sales
,
a
.
avg_thirtyday_sales
,
a
.
avg_thirtyday_sales
,
a
.
avg_sales
,
a
.
avg_sales
,
a
.
avg_weighting_day_sales
,
sale_putin_id
=
a
.
sale_putin_id
>
0
?
"不合理"
:
"合理"
sale_putin_id
=
a
.
sale_putin_id
>
0
?
"不合理"
:
"合理"
});
});
...
@@ -6551,13 +6553,15 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
...
@@ -6551,13 +6553,15 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
a
.
avg_fourteenday_sales
,
a
.
avg_fourteenday_sales
,
a
.
avg_thirtyday_sales
,
a
.
avg_thirtyday_sales
,
a
.
avg_sales
,
a
.
avg_sales
,
sale_putin_id
=
a
.
sale_putin_id
>
0
?
"不合理"
:
"合理"
sale_putin_id
=
a
.
sale_putin_id
>
0
?
"不合理"
:
"合理"
,
a
.
category_simple_name
,
a
.
avg_weighting_day_sales
});
});
var
colNames
=
new
List
<
string
>()
{
"仓库类型"
,
"仓库名称"
,
"sku"
,
"出库数量"
,
"出库金额"
,
"入库数量"
,
"入途金额"
,
"(入库-出库)数量"
,
"(入库-出库)金额"
};
;
var
colNames
=
new
List
<
string
>()
{
"仓库类型"
,
"仓库名称"
,
"sku"
,
"百伦简单分录"
,
"出库数量"
,
"出库金额"
,
"入库数量"
,
"入途金额"
,
"(入库-出库)数量"
,
"(入库-出库)金额"
};
;
colNames
.
AddRange
(
new
List
<
string
>
{
"是否清货"
,
"是否新品"
,
"
可用库存"
,
"7日日均"
,
"14日日均"
,
"30日
日均"
,
"可消耗天数"
,
"是否合理"
});
colNames
.
AddRange
(
new
List
<
string
>
{
"是否清货"
,
"是否新品"
,
"
是否Aims下单"
,
"可用库存"
,
"7日日均"
,
"14日日均"
,
"30日日均"
,
"加权
日均"
,
"可消耗天数"
,
"是否合理"
});
...
@@ -6565,8 +6569,8 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
...
@@ -6565,8 +6569,8 @@ namespace Bailun.DC.Web.Areas.Reports.Controllers
var
listval
=
new
List
<
string
>();
var
listval
=
new
List
<
string
>();
foreach
(
var
item
in
list
)
foreach
(
var
item
in
list
)
{
{
listval
.
Add
(
item
.
warehouse_type
+
"|"
+
item
.
warehouse_name
+
"|"
+
item
.
bailun_sku
+
"|"
+
item
.
count_outbound
+
"|"
+
item
.
amount_outbound
+
"|"
+
listval
.
Add
(
item
.
warehouse_type
+
"|"
+
item
.
warehouse_name
+
"|"
+
item
.
bailun_sku
+
"|"
+
item
.
category_simple_name
+
"|"
+
item
.
count_outbound
+
"|"
+
item
.
amount_outbound
+
"|"
+
item
.
count_putin
+
"|"
+
item
.
amount_putin
+
"|"
+
item
.
count_diff
+
"|"
+
item
.
amount_diff
+(
"|"
+
item
.
is_clear
+
"|"
+
item
.
is_new
+
"|"
+
item
.
count_usable_stock
+
"|"
+
item
.
avg_sevenday_sales
+
"|"
+
item
.
avg_fourteenday_sales
+
"|"
+
item
.
avg_thirty
day_sales
+
"|"
+
item
.
avg_sales
+
"|"
+
item
.
sale_putin_id
)
item
.
count_putin
+
"|"
+
item
.
amount_putin
+
"|"
+
item
.
count_diff
+
"|"
+
item
.
amount_diff
+(
"|"
+
item
.
is_clear
+
"|"
+
item
.
is_new
+
"|"
+
item
.
is_aimsorder
+
"|"
+
item
.
count_usable_stock
+
"|"
+
item
.
avg_sevenday_sales
+
"|"
+
item
.
avg_fourteenday_sales
+
"|"
+
item
.
avg_thirtyday_sales
+
"|"
+
item
.
avg_weighting_
day_sales
+
"|"
+
item
.
avg_sales
+
"|"
+
item
.
sale_putin_id
)
);
);
}
}
...
...
Bailun.DC.Web/Areas/Reports/Views/Finance/ListUnReasonable.cshtml
View file @
db8a322b
...
@@ -22,11 +22,11 @@
...
@@ -22,11 +22,11 @@
</select>
</select>
</div>
</div>
@*<div class="form-group">
@*<div class="form-group">
<label>仓库:</label>
<label>仓库:</label>
<select id="warehouse" name="warehouse" class="form-control">
<select id="warehouse" name="warehouse" class="form-control">
<option value="">请选择仓库</option>
<option value="">请选择仓库</option>
</select>
</select>
</div>*@
</div>*@
<div class="form-group">
<div class="form-group">
<label>请选择开始月份</label>
<label>请选择开始月份</label>
<input id="month" name="month" class="form-control" style="width:130px;" placeholder="年-月" value="@(ViewBag.month)" />
<input id="month" name="month" class="form-control" style="width:130px;" placeholder="年-月" value="@(ViewBag.month)" />
...
@@ -64,6 +64,14 @@
...
@@ -64,6 +64,14 @@
</select>
</select>
</div>
</div>
<div class="form-group">
<div class="form-group">
<label>是否Aims下单</label>
<select id="isaims" name="isaims" class="form-control">
<option value="">请选择</option>
<option value="1">是</option>
<option value="0">否</option>
</select>
</div>
<div class="form-group">
<label> </label>
<label> </label>
<button type="button" class="btn btn-primary" onclick="list();"><i class="fa fa-search"></i> 查询</button>
<button type="button" class="btn btn-primary" onclick="list();"><i class="fa fa-search"></i> 查询</button>
<button id="btnexport" style="display:none;" type="button" class="btn btn-success" onclick="exportlist();">导出</button>
<button id="btnexport" style="display:none;" type="button" class="btn btn-success" onclick="exportlist();">导出</button>
...
@@ -115,6 +123,7 @@
...
@@ -115,6 +123,7 @@
{ field: 'warehouse_type', title: '仓库类型', width: '130', iscount: true, sortable: true },
{ field: 'warehouse_type', title: '仓库类型', width: '130', iscount: true, sortable: true },
{ field: 'warehouse_name', title: '仓库名称', width: '160', iscount: true, sortable: true },
{ field: 'warehouse_name', title: '仓库名称', width: '160', iscount: true, sortable: true },
{ field: 'bailun_sku', title: 'sku', width: '180', iscount: true, sortable: true },
{ field: 'bailun_sku', title: 'sku', width: '180', iscount: true, sortable: true },
{ field: 'category_simple_name', title: '百伦分类', width: '130' },
{ field: 'count_outbound', title: '出库数量', width: '110', iscount: true, sortable: true },
{ field: 'count_outbound', title: '出库数量', width: '110', iscount: true, sortable: true },
{ field: 'amount_outbound', title: '出库金额', width: '110', iscount: true },
{ field: 'amount_outbound', title: '出库金额', width: '110', iscount: true },
{ field: 'count_putin', title: '入库数量', width: '110', iscount: true, sortable: true },
{ field: 'count_putin', title: '入库数量', width: '110', iscount: true, sortable: true },
...
@@ -125,6 +134,7 @@
...
@@ -125,6 +134,7 @@
columns.push({ field: 'is_clear', title: '是否清货', width: '110', sortable: true });
columns.push({ field: 'is_clear', title: '是否清货', width: '110', sortable: true });
columns.push({ field: 'is_new', title: '是否新品', width: '110', sortable: true });
columns.push({ field: 'is_new', title: '是否新品', width: '110', sortable: true });
columns.push({ field: 'is_aimsorder', title: 'Aims下单', width: '110', sortable: true });
columns.push({ field: 'count_usable_stock', title: '可用库存', width: '110', sortable: true, iscount: true });
columns.push({ field: 'count_usable_stock', title: '可用库存', width: '110', sortable: true, iscount: true });
columns.push({ field: 'avg_sevenday_sales', title: '7日日均', width: '110' });
columns.push({ field: 'avg_sevenday_sales', title: '7日日均', width: '110' });
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ment